# Break-Glass: Catalog Cache Invalidation

Scope: the Pinrow product catalog at Veldstone Retail. If stale prices persist after a purge and the Hollowmere invalidation queue is wedged, use break-glass to flush the edge tier directly. Contractors: get verbal sign-off from the catalog lead first. Steps: open the Hollowmere admin shell, select emergency-flush, confirm the tenant, and run it once — repeated flushes thrash the origin. Access is logged and expires after 20 minutes. Unseal the admin shell with the passphrase below.

recovery phrase for kahop-tajog: istix-casvan

## Migration Step 4 — Adopt the Pinwale pinning policy

All dependencies must now be pinned to exact versions; range specifiers are rejected at build time. Reviewers should confirm that lockfiles are regenerated from the approved registry mirror only. Once the policy file is in place, verify it matches the enforcement settings shown below.

settings of tagef-bawif:
DRUIX_HOST=druix.zemvarlabs.internal
DRUIX_PORT=8000

Ticket #— Floor 9 Opening Prep, Brindlemoor House

Hi facilities folks, Floor 9 opens to staff next Monday and we need a few things squared away before then. Lift access is live, but the two side doors by the kitchenette are still on the old lock config — please reprogram them before Friday. Also, signage for the quiet rooms hasn't arrived, so pop up the temporary printed ones for now. Until the badge readers sync, the interim door code for Floor 9 is below.

door code, bajop-bajog: bdg-DSWAC-43621

[ ] Key ceremony step 7 — Relayd websocket patch

Before signing the 4.2.1 hotfix for the reconnect loop (clients hammering the Qorvane gateway after idle timeout), confirm the fix branch is merged and the staging soak passed 24h. The signing HSM at the Drellbury site was re-initialized last month, so the old operator phrase is dead. Two witnesses required. Release manager unlocks the signing partition first. When the terminal prompts for operator recovery, enter the passphrase printed directly below.

unlock words, tawif-tahop: oliys-ulawyn-tamdor-lamys-casox-jormir-fraius-kasath-ulador-ulamir-holir-sorys-holeth